Overview

The authority is seeking Contractor(s) for the supply of Mass Spectrometry and Chromatography Equipment including Associated Servicing, Maintenance and Repairs for the further and higher education sector and other public bodies in Scotland and the UK. How to Read This Tender

  • 1This is a 'framework agreement' — it means APUC and partner consortia set up a supplier agreement, but individual institutions order and pay separately as they need equipment. You're not supplying one big order; you're available when members place orders.
  • 2Check the membership lists on each consortium's website — your customers will be drawn from these organisations. The contract covers a very wide geographic area (all of UK) and multiple sectors (universities, colleges, NHS, government bodies, cultural institutions).
  • 3Look for the 'Call-Off' or 'Schedule of Rates' section in full documents — this will show what prices you need to quote and what payment terms apply when members order from you.
  • 4The notice mentions 'Full and Associate Members, and future members' — this means the contract could apply to new institutions joining these consortia during the agreement period, so you're committing to serve a potentially expanding customer base.
  • 5Servicing, maintenance, and repairs are a key part of this contract — don't just bid on equipment supply. Budget for having local support, spare parts availability, and response times to member institutions.

Tips for Small Businesses

  • Consider whether you can realistically support multiple consortia across the entire UK — if you're small, you might subcontract repair and maintenance work to local specialists in different regions, or partner with larger distributors who can handle the logistics.
  • This is a 'call-off' framework, not a guaranteed order. You compete now to get on the approved supplier list, but individual universities then choose whether to buy from you. Winning institutions' business will depend on your pricing, equipment quality, and after-sales service — don't assume you'll get revenue just from being approved.
  • If you're a small equipment supplier without your own service network, partner with or subcontract to established technical support companies in target regions. Universities and hospitals care deeply about maintenance responsiveness — a guarantee of 24-48 hour repair support could be a major selling point.
